Comprehensive Guide to Auto Expense Form

What is the Automobile Expenses Form?

The Automobile Expenses Form is a crucial document for individuals seeking to calculate and report deductible automobile expenses related to business use. This form enables users to choose between two methods for reporting: the standard mileage method and the actual expense method. The standard mileage method allows taxpayers to deduct a predetermined rate per mile driven for business purposes, while the actual expense method entails deducting actual costs incurred, including fuel, maintenance, and insurance.

Purpose and Benefits of Using the Automobile Expenses Form

This form maximizes business mileage deductions by providing detailed reporting options for expenses incurred while using a vehicle for work. Choosing the right deduction method is essential to optimize tax savings. The standard mileage rate is simpler, whereas the actual expense method may yield higher deductions, depending on individual circumstances.

Information Required to Fill Out the Automobile Expenses Form

To successfully complete the Automobile Expenses Form, the following information is typically required:
  • Vehicle make and model
  • Total miles driven
  • Business miles driven
  • Interest paid on car loans
  • Personal property tax
  • Business parking and toll expenses
  • Approximate yearly commuting mileage
Additionally, supporting documents such as receipts for expenses and mileage logs may be necessary to substantiate deductions claimed on the form.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Completing the Automobile Expenses Form

Users often make errors that can jeopardize their deductions. Some common mistakes include:
  • Overstating personal versus business mileage
  • Failing to document expenses accurately
  • Not choosing the most beneficial deduction method
